Sacramental Preparation
Betty Murphy (Parish Youth Worker) co-ordinates the “Do this in Memory” program for 1st Holy Communion children and their parents and the Confirmation programme for the children and their parents.
The PPC took on the project of reading the ‘Confirmation Scrapbook.’ Each child preparing for Confirmation completed a scrapbook. This culminated in the presentation of these scrapbooks to the children by the PPC at their Graduation Service on 25th June. For the coming year the PPC designed the scrapbook and presented each child with one to complete during the year in the preparation for their Confirmation in 2010.
Communication with local Parishes
During the course of the year the Parish Councils of Eadestown, Manor Kilbride,Valleymount/Lacken and Blessington met together on three different occasions. These meetings are very valuable, both to discuss emerging issues, in addition to providing mutual support. One of these meetings also included the PPC’s from Saggart, Rathcoole, Newcastle and Brittas. This particular meeting was addressed by Fr. Kieran O’ Carroll from the office of Evangelisation. Bishop Eamonn Walsh was also in attendance. This was a pleasant enthusiastic discourse.
West Wicklow Adult Religious Education Centre
This year saw the emergence of the West Wicklow Adult Religious Education Centre under the directorship of Fr. Joe Cullen. The first pilot course for the West Wicklow region took place in September/ October in the Parish Centre. This was extremely well attended and many of the participants received certificates of completion on the closing night.
